What is an Internship Automation Engineer job?

An Internship Automation Engineer is a temporary role where students or recent graduates gain hands-on experience in automation engineering. Interns typically assist in designing, developing, and testing automated systems, scripts, or processes to improve efficiency. They work with engineering teams to troubleshoot automation issues, analyze system performance, and document solutions. This role provides exposure to software tools, programming languages, and industry best practices in automation. It's an excellent opportunity to build technical and problem-solving skills in a real-world engineering environment.

What types of projects and daily tasks can I expect as an Internship Automation Engineer?

As an Internship Automation Engineer, you’ll typically work on assisting with the design, development, and testing of automated systems or scripts used to streamline processes. Your daily tasks may include writing and debugging code, preparing documentation, participating in team meetings, and supporting senior engineers with ongoing projects. You might also conduct automated testing, analyze data for process optimization, and help troubleshoot technical issues. This role offers hands-on experience that is valuable for developing both technical and professional skills, while providing opportunities to collaborate closely with cross-functional engineering and IT te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Internship Automation Eng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internship Automation Engineer,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Python, Java, or C#), engineering principles, and automation concepts, usually supported by ongoing or completed coursework in related fields. Experience with automation tools like Selenium, Jenkins, or PLC systems, as well as familiarity with version control platforms like Git, is often required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work collaboratively in a team environment are key soft skills. These abilities are essential for developing, testing, and maintaining automated solutions that improve efficiency and reliability in technical projects.

Job description


Position Summary:
The Operational Excellence Analyst is primarily responsible for completing tasks directly or indirectly supporting key initiatives within the Operational Excellence department. The main tasks include, but are not limited to: Industrial Engineering related assignments, Data organization, manipulation, visualization and analysis, Documentation design, creation, and organization, & Identification and development of process improvements.
Major Responsibilities:
- Data Analysis / Report Generation:
-Automate data retrieval and visualization processes
-Perform analytics per traditional and new approaches
-Develop and maintain data visualization dashboards
- Process Improvement / Process Automation:
-Develop as is process mapping / analysis
-Identify waste and develop solutions
-Develop automation techniques to reduce waste
- Time Studies / Process Observation:
-Observe processes at PTL and PL locations
-Execute time studies: Setup - Execute - Report Out
-Develop findings and recommendations reports
- Documentation Creation / Content Management:
-Develop and maintain SOPs to support initiatives
-Manage collaborate document management portals
-Develop and maintain key departmental documents
-Other projects as assigned by the supervisor
